Домашняя страница Undo Do New Save Карта сайта Обратная связь Поиск по форуму
МИР MS EXCEL - Гость.xls

Вход

Регистрация

Напомнить пароль

 

= Мир MS Excel/найти одинаковые ячейки в столбце и... - Мир MS Excel

Старая форма входа
  • Страница 1 из 1
  • 1
Модератор форума: китин, _Boroda_  
найти одинаковые ячейки в столбце и...
FCSM Дата: Среда, 09.10.2013, 15:13 | Сообщение № 1
Группа: Гости
Здравствуйте.
В excel-е, к сожалению, полный чайник. Помогите решить следующую задачу.
Есть 2 столбца. (Поле1, Поле2)
Поле 1 содержит числа от 1 до 50.
Поле 2 - текстовое.
Задача: найти одинаковые ячейки в Поле2, сравнить их соответствующие ячейки в Поле1, вычислить среди них максимальное, и это максимальное значение вставить в Поле 3 - во всех одинаковых ячейках.

Т.е. Поле 3 должно получиться таким:

поле1 имя-файла поле3
25 имя1 25
10 имя2 11
15 имя1 25
18 имя3 18
11 имя2 11
30 имя4 30

Заранее СПАСИБО за помощь.
 
Ответить
СообщениеЗдравствуйте.
В excel-е, к сожалению, полный чайник. Помогите решить следующую задачу.
Есть 2 столбца. (Поле1, Поле2)
Поле 1 содержит числа от 1 до 50.
Поле 2 - текстовое.
Задача: найти одинаковые ячейки в Поле2, сравнить их соответствующие ячейки в Поле1, вычислить среди них максимальное, и это максимальное значение вставить в Поле 3 - во всех одинаковых ячейках.

Т.е. Поле 3 должно получиться таким:

поле1 имя-файла поле3
25 имя1 25
10 имя2 11
15 имя1 25
18 имя3 18
11 имя2 11
30 имя4 30

Заранее СПАСИБО за помощь.

Автор - FCSM
Дата добавления - 09.10.2013 в 15:13
AlexM Дата: Среда, 09.10.2013, 15:26 | Сообщение № 2
Группа: Друзья
Ранг: Участник клуба
Сообщений: 4517
Репутация: 1129 ±
Замечаний: 0% ±

Excel 2003
Что такое Поле 1 и Поле 2?
Приложите к вопросу файл пример, как рекомендовано в правилах форума.
В файле покажите что у вас не получается.



Номер мобильного модема (без голосовой связи)
9269171249 МегаФон, Московский регион.
 
Ответить
СообщениеЧто такое Поле 1 и Поле 2?
Приложите к вопросу файл пример, как рекомендовано в правилах форума.
В файле покажите что у вас не получается.

Автор - AlexM
Дата добавления - 09.10.2013 в 15:26
FCSM Дата: Среда, 09.10.2013, 15:34 | Сообщение № 3
Группа: Гости
Поле1 - условное название Столбца1 с данными.
Поле2 - условное название Столбца2 с данными.
Поле3 - условное название Столбца3, который нужно получить.
 
Ответить
СообщениеПоле1 - условное название Столбца1 с данными.
Поле2 - условное название Столбца2 с данными.
Поле3 - условное название Столбца3, который нужно получить.

Автор - FCSM
Дата добавления - 09.10.2013 в 15:34
SkyPro Дата: Среда, 09.10.2013, 15:51 | Сообщение № 4
Группа: Друзья
Ранг: Старожил
Сообщений: 1206
Репутация: 255 ±
Замечаний: 0% ±

2010
Код
=МАКС(($A$1:$A$6)*($B$1:$B$6=B1))

Формула массива.

Если нужно отображать только если совпадений 2 и больше, тогда так:
Код
=ЕСЛИ(СЧЁТЕСЛИ($B$1:$B$6;B1)=1;"";МАКС(($A$1:$A$6)*($B$1:$B$6=B1)))
Или:
Код
=ЕСЛИ(СУММ(--($B$1:$B$6=B1))<2;"";МАКС(($A$1:$A$6)*($B$1:$B$6=B1)))
Или:
Код
=ВЫБОР(--(СЧЁТЕСЛИ($B$1:$B$6;B1)>1)+1;"";МАКС(($A$1:$A$6)*($B$1:$B$6=B1)))


Тоже массивные.


skypro1111@gmail.com

Сообщение отредактировал SkyPro - Среда, 09.10.2013, 16:18
 
Ответить
Сообщение
Код
=МАКС(($A$1:$A$6)*($B$1:$B$6=B1))

Формула массива.

Если нужно отображать только если совпадений 2 и больше, тогда так:
Код
=ЕСЛИ(СЧЁТЕСЛИ($B$1:$B$6;B1)=1;"";МАКС(($A$1:$A$6)*($B$1:$B$6=B1)))
Или:
Код
=ЕСЛИ(СУММ(--($B$1:$B$6=B1))<2;"";МАКС(($A$1:$A$6)*($B$1:$B$6=B1)))
Или:
Код
=ВЫБОР(--(СЧЁТЕСЛИ($B$1:$B$6;B1)>1)+1;"";МАКС(($A$1:$A$6)*($B$1:$B$6=B1)))


Тоже массивные.

Автор - SkyPro
Дата добавления - 09.10.2013 в 15:51
FCSM Дата: Среда, 09.10.2013, 16:14 | Сообщение № 5
Группа: Пользователи
Ранг: Прохожий
Сообщений: 7
Репутация: 0 ±
Замечаний: 20% ±

Excel 2007
Skypro, спасибо за совет, но ничего не понял.. :(
Сейчас присоединю файл excel - может поможет...

Из примера - "Имя1" встречается во 2-ой и 4-ой строке. Анализируем ячейку А2 (содержит - 25) и А4 (содержит 15). А2>А4, поэтому Е2=А2, Е4=А2. (записываем в третий столбец)
"Имя2" встречается в 3-ей и 6-ой строке. Сравниваем А3 и А6. А6>A3, поэтому Е3 и Е6=А6 (11).
"Имя3" встречается только 1 раз - в пятой строке - поэтому Е5=А5 (18)
"Имя4" встречается только 1 раз - в 7-ой строке - поэтому Е7=А7 (30).

Попробуйте помочь на доступном для Эксель-чайника языке.
К сообщению приложен файл: 3079420.xlsx (8.3 Kb)
 
Ответить
СообщениеSkypro, спасибо за совет, но ничего не понял.. :(
Сейчас присоединю файл excel - может поможет...

Из примера - "Имя1" встречается во 2-ой и 4-ой строке. Анализируем ячейку А2 (содержит - 25) и А4 (содержит 15). А2>А4, поэтому Е2=А2, Е4=А2. (записываем в третий столбец)
"Имя2" встречается в 3-ей и 6-ой строке. Сравниваем А3 и А6. А6>A3, поэтому Е3 и Е6=А6 (11).
"Имя3" встречается только 1 раз - в пятой строке - поэтому Е5=А5 (18)
"Имя4" встречается только 1 раз - в 7-ой строке - поэтому Е7=А7 (30).

Попробуйте помочь на доступном для Эксель-чайника языке.

Автор - FCSM
Дата добавления - 09.10.2013 в 16:14
китин Дата: Среда, 09.10.2013, 16:17 | Сообщение № 6
Группа: Модераторы
Ранг: Экселист
Сообщений: 7029
Репутация: 1078 ±
Замечаний: 0% ±

Excel 2007;2010;2016
ну можно и так.я так понял
Код
=ЕСЛИ(СЧЁТЕСЛИ($B$1:$B$6;$B1)=1;ИНДЕКС($A$1:$B$6;ПОИСКПОЗ($B1;$B$1:$B$6;0);1);МАКС(($B$1:$B$6=$B1)*$A$1:$A$6))

Массивная


Не судите очень строго:я пытаюсь научиться
ЯД 41001877306852


Сообщение отредактировал китин - Среда, 09.10.2013, 16:18
 
Ответить
Сообщениену можно и так.я так понял
Код
=ЕСЛИ(СЧЁТЕСЛИ($B$1:$B$6;$B1)=1;ИНДЕКС($A$1:$B$6;ПОИСКПОЗ($B1;$B$1:$B$6;0);1);МАКС(($B$1:$B$6=$B1)*$A$1:$A$6))

Массивная

Автор - китин
Дата добавления - 09.10.2013 в 16:17
SkyPro Дата: Среда, 09.10.2013, 16:22 | Сообщение № 7
Группа: Друзья
Ранг: Старожил
Сообщений: 1206
Репутация: 255 ±
Замечаний: 0% ±

2010
Вот:

ЗЫ: Добавил все 4 варианта.
К сообщению приложен файл: 1156852.xlsx (10.1 Kb)


skypro1111@gmail.com

Сообщение отредактировал SkyPro - Среда, 09.10.2013, 16:26
 
Ответить
СообщениеВот:

ЗЫ: Добавил все 4 варианта.

Автор - SkyPro
Дата добавления - 09.10.2013 в 16:22
китин Дата: Среда, 09.10.2013, 16:24 | Сообщение № 8
Группа: Модераторы
Ранг: Экселист
Сообщений: 7029
Репутация: 1078 ±
Замечаний: 0% ±

Excel 2007;2010;2016
смотрите,что пойдет
К сообщению приложен файл: 3079420_22.xlsx (10.4 Kb)


Не судите очень строго:я пытаюсь научиться
ЯД 41001877306852
 
Ответить
Сообщениесмотрите,что пойдет

Автор - китин
Дата добавления - 09.10.2013 в 16:24
FCSM Дата: Среда, 09.10.2013, 16:34 | Сообщение № 9
Группа: Пользователи
Ранг: Прохожий
Сообщений: 7
Репутация: 0 ±
Замечаний: 20% ±

Excel 2007
ОГРОМНОЕ ВСЕМ СПАСИБО ЗА ОЧЕНЬ ОПЕРАТИВНУЮ ПОМОЩЬ - НЕ ОЖИДАЛ :)
Сейчас постараюсь разобраться во всем этом и прикрутить к своей задаче - позже отпишу :)
 
Ответить
СообщениеОГРОМНОЕ ВСЕМ СПАСИБО ЗА ОЧЕНЬ ОПЕРАТИВНУЮ ПОМОЩЬ - НЕ ОЖИДАЛ :)
Сейчас постараюсь разобраться во всем этом и прикрутить к своей задаче - позже отпишу :)

Автор - FCSM
Дата добавления - 09.10.2013 в 16:34
SkyPro Дата: Среда, 09.10.2013, 16:41 | Сообщение № 10
Группа: Друзья
Ранг: Старожил
Сообщений: 1206
Репутация: 255 ±
Замечаний: 0% ±

2010
китин, не правильно мои формулы прикрутили :)


skypro1111@gmail.com
 
Ответить
Сообщениекитин, не правильно мои формулы прикрутили :)

Автор - SkyPro
Дата добавления - 09.10.2013 в 16:41
FCSM Дата: Среда, 09.10.2013, 16:59 | Сообщение № 11
Группа: Пользователи
Ранг: Прохожий
Сообщений: 7
Репутация: 0 ±
Замечаний: 20% ±

Excel 2007
Попробовал прикрутить - не работает :( (хотя в ваших файлах - все получается).
Посмотрите, пожалуйста, где ошибка. Файл прилагается.
К сообщению приложен файл: 7361147.xlsx (9.6 Kb)
 
Ответить
СообщениеПопробовал прикрутить - не работает :( (хотя в ваших файлах - все получается).
Посмотрите, пожалуйста, где ошибка. Файл прилагается.

Автор - FCSM
Дата добавления - 09.10.2013 в 16:59
SkyPro Дата: Среда, 09.10.2013, 17:03 | Сообщение № 12
Группа: Друзья
Ранг: Старожил
Сообщений: 1206
Репутация: 255 ±
Замечаний: 0% ±

2010
1. Уберите обьединение ячеек, если хотите получить результат. (+ это избавит вас от других проблем)
2. Формулу вводите через нажатие ctrl + shift + enter (Формула массива, о которой вам говорили в каждом посте).
К сообщению приложен файл: 7361147-1-.xlsx (9.8 Kb)


skypro1111@gmail.com

Сообщение отредактировал SkyPro - Среда, 09.10.2013, 17:04
 
Ответить
Сообщение1. Уберите обьединение ячеек, если хотите получить результат. (+ это избавит вас от других проблем)
2. Формулу вводите через нажатие ctrl + shift + enter (Формула массива, о которой вам говорили в каждом посте).

Автор - SkyPro
Дата добавления - 09.10.2013 в 17:03
FCSM Дата: Среда, 09.10.2013, 17:08 | Сообщение № 13
Группа: Пользователи
Ранг: Прохожий
Сообщений: 7
Репутация: 0 ±
Замечаний: 20% ±

Excel 2007
Понял. СПАСИБО.
Объединение убирать мне нельзя. Попробую тогда копировать из объединенных ячеек данные в простые ячейки и там их уже обрабатывать.
 
Ответить
СообщениеПонял. СПАСИБО.
Объединение убирать мне нельзя. Попробую тогда копировать из объединенных ячеек данные в простые ячейки и там их уже обрабатывать.

Автор - FCSM
Дата добавления - 09.10.2013 в 17:08
Pelena Дата: Среда, 09.10.2013, 17:11 | Сообщение № 14
Группа: Админы
Ранг: Местный житель
Сообщений: 19407
Репутация: 4556 ±
Замечаний: ±

Excel 365 & Mac Excel
Снимите объединение -- скорректируйте формулу -- верните объединение -- протяните формулу вниз


"Черт возьми, Холмс! Но как??!!"
Ю-money 41001765434816
 
Ответить
СообщениеСнимите объединение -- скорректируйте формулу -- верните объединение -- протяните формулу вниз

Автор - Pelena
Дата добавления - 09.10.2013 в 17:11
FCSM Дата: Среда, 09.10.2013, 17:32 | Сообщение № 15
Группа: Пользователи
Ранг: Прохожий
Сообщений: 7
Репутация: 0 ±
Замечаний: 20% ±

Excel 2007
Еще раз всем - ОГРОМНОЕ СПАСИБО.
Получилось. (копирую данные из объединенных ячеек во временные - необъединенные :) и там уже их обрабатываю).
Pelena, спасибо, но я не знаю как это сделать (здесь смущающийся смайл чайника)
 
Ответить
СообщениеЕще раз всем - ОГРОМНОЕ СПАСИБО.
Получилось. (копирую данные из объединенных ячеек во временные - необъединенные :) и там уже их обрабатываю).
Pelena, спасибо, но я не знаю как это сделать (здесь смущающийся смайл чайника)

Автор - FCSM
Дата добавления - 09.10.2013 в 17:32
китин Дата: Среда, 09.10.2013, 17:51 | Сообщение № 16
Группа: Модераторы
Ранг: Экселист
Сообщений: 7029
Репутация: 1078 ±
Замечаний: 0% ±

Excel 2007;2010;2016
SkyPro, я только диапазоны по месту подправил.а так чистейший копипаст


Не судите очень строго:я пытаюсь научиться
ЯД 41001877306852
 
Ответить
СообщениеSkyPro, я только диапазоны по месту подправил.а так чистейший копипаст

Автор - китин
Дата добавления - 09.10.2013 в 17:51
Pelena Дата: Среда, 09.10.2013, 17:56 | Сообщение № 17
Группа: Админы
Ранг: Местный житель
Сообщений: 19407
Репутация: 4556 ±
Замечаний: ±

Excel 365 & Mac Excel
я не знаю как это сделать

Откройте для себя кнопку на Главной вкладке
К сообщению приложен файл: 9158154.jpg (2.7 Kb)


"Черт возьми, Холмс! Но как??!!"
Ю-money 41001765434816
 
Ответить
Сообщение
я не знаю как это сделать

Откройте для себя кнопку на Главной вкладке

Автор - Pelena
Дата добавления - 09.10.2013 в 17:56
Найти одинаковые ячейки Дата: Вторник, 01.04.2014, 12:16 | Сообщение № 18
Группа: Гости
Помогите найти одинаковые ячейки . У меня 4 столбца (A B C D) , в столбце А представлены весь список фамилий , в столбце C только те, которые нужно найти в списке А . Столбцы B и C это номера полисов , мне нужно найти различающиеся полиса.
[moder]Читаем Правила форума
Один вопрос - одна тема
И прикладываем свой пример в Excel
Эта тема закрыта
 
Ответить
СообщениеПомогите найти одинаковые ячейки . У меня 4 столбца (A B C D) , в столбце А представлены весь список фамилий , в столбце C только те, которые нужно найти в списке А . Столбцы B и C это номера полисов , мне нужно найти различающиеся полиса.
[moder]Читаем Правила форума
Один вопрос - одна тема
И прикладываем свой пример в Excel
Эта тема закрыта

Автор - Найти одинаковые ячейки
Дата добавления - 01.04.2014 в 12:16
  • Страница 1 из 1
  • 1
Поиск:

Яндекс.Метрика Яндекс цитирования
© 2010-2024 · Дизайн: MichaelCH · Хостинг от uCoz · При использовании материалов сайта, ссылка на www.excelworld.ru обязательна!